libretiny: scope BK72xx IRAM_ATTR to BK7231N; T/Q/7251 stay no-op
BK7231T / BK7231Q / BK7251 share a LibreTiny linker template that only declares flash + ram, no executable RAM region. Their SDK wraps flash writes in GLOBAL_INT_DISABLE() which masks both FIQ and IRQ, so no ISR fires while flash is stalled and the "code in flash while flash is busy" scenario IRAM_ATTR is guarding against does not occur on those variants. Map IRAM_ATTR to nothing on them rather than orphan-linking .sram.text into flash and drop the T/Q/7251 entries from _PATCHERS_BY_VARIANT so the pre-link hook is not registered for them. BK7231N still gets the full fix (grown .itcm.code) because its SDK takes the defense-in-depth route of also placing flash/ISR/FreeRTOS critical code in ITCM, so our IRAM_ATTR functions need to live there too. Also make _grow_bk72xx_itcm fail loudly if the tcm/itcm declarations in the BK7231N template ever change shape, matching the fail-hard stance of the rest of the script.
